Arie di Arie di Opere (Ferruccio Tagliavini with the Sinfonica dell' E.I.A.R., Ugo Tansini conducting; Cetra, 6 sides). The new hero of the Met's Italian fans (TIME, Jan. 20) sings arias from six operas (Mignon, Tosca, Rigoletto, The Barber of Seville, Manon, Elisir d'Amore). The Italian tempi are perhaps a little languid for U.S. tastes, but Tagliavini's contralto-like pianissimi are wondrously lyrical. The imported Italian discs (which cost a whopping $3.25 each) are technically as good as most U.S. recordings. Performance: excellent...

With the help of three-inch elevated shoes, Tito Schipa looked all of five-feet-five last week at Paris' Salle Pleyel. When he sang L'Elisir d'Amore and Don Giovanni he brought the house down. He gave so many encores that for a while it seemed that only firehoses could send the cheering mobs home...
